| - name: Wait for new deepctl version on PyPI | |
| run: | | |
| set -euo pipefail | |
| VERSION="${TAG_NAME#v}" | |
| # Poll the PyPI JSON API rather than `pip index versions`. The | |
| # JSON endpoint flips the moment a release is published, while | |
| # the simple index pip queries can lag 5-15 minutes behind a | |
| # successful publish (CDN caching of project metadata). | |
| URL="https://pypi.org/pypi/deepctl/${VERSION}/json" | |
| for i in $(seq 1 30); do | |
| if [ "$(curl -fsS -o /dev/null -w '%{http_code}' "${URL}")" = "200" ]; then | |
| echo "deepctl==${VERSION} is live on PyPI" | |
| exit 0 | |
| fi | |
| echo "Waiting for deepctl==${VERSION} on PyPI (${i}/30)..." | |
| sleep 20 | |
| done | |
| echo "::error::deepctl==${VERSION} did not appear on PyPI after 10 minutes" | |
| exit 1 | |
| env: | |
| TAG_NAME: ${{ needs.release-please.outputs.tag_name }} | |
